Test: Disable parallelism to ensure serial execution
authorHannah von Reth <hannah.vonreth@owncloud.com>
Wed, 1 Apr 2020 09:39:56 +0000 (11:39 +0200)
committerKevin Ottens <kevin.ottens@nextcloud.com>
Tue, 15 Dec 2020 09:59:10 +0000 (10:59 +0100)
test/testsyncmove.cpp

index d0e05370898aaf6c5d0fcf4c5a9dc2729faf47db..67809f7e1e39c689ff38c4ed6a8e753b9d7baa77 100644 (file)
@@ -889,6 +889,9 @@ private slots:
         const QString src = "folder/folderA/file.txt";
         const QString dest = "folder/folderB/file.txt";
         FakeFolder fakeFolder{ FileInfo{ QString(), { FileInfo{ QStringLiteral("folder"), { FileInfo{ QStringLiteral("folderA"), { { QStringLiteral("file.txt"), 400 } } }, QStringLiteral("folderB") } } } } };
+        auto syncOpts = fakeFolder.syncEngine().syncOptions();
+        syncOpts._parallelNetworkJobs = 0;
+        fakeFolder.syncEngine().setSyncOptions(syncOpts);
 
         QCOMPARE(fakeFolder.currentLocalState(), fakeFolder.currentRemoteState());